DESCRIPTION
This session will provide a review of the progress made in understanding the effects of cold temperature storage on platelets. A recent breakthrough discovery explains why platelets exposed to cold temperatures are cleared from circulation after transfusion. Two distinguished speakers will describe the effects of the cold exposure in molecular terms and outline how the new discoveries may lead to practical solutions of storing platelets in the cold.

OBJECTIVES

  • Discuss the effects of cold temperature storage on platelet performance in vivo
  • Describe novel molecular mechanisms of the platelet response to cold temperatures
  • Explain how the new discoveries can be translated into practical application for platelet cold storage
